For the next several days, families will gather at various spots throughout the Magic Valley to take pictures as area high schools prepare to host graduation ceremonies.

For anyone who might be trying to determine the best locations to take pictures for graduation invitations or post-ceremony, cap and gown photos, there are a few backdrops to consider beforehand.

The Snake River Canyon is one of southern Idaho's biggest tourist draws, but for locals, it's often underappreciated. The Snake River Gorge is perhaps the best spot to get incredible pictures of graduates during one of the biggest weeks of their lives.

Graduates and Their Families Have Several Great Spots to Take Pictures Near Twin Falls

One of the unique things about living in southern Idaho is the number of different landscapes that make up the region. Within an hour's drive from Twin Falls, there are beautiful waterfalls, crystal clear springs, some of the tallest sand dunes in America, and top-notch rivers and lakes, all provide wonderful photo opportunities.

One of the most popular spots where families gather for graduation pictures is along the water's edge near Centennial Park. From this vantage point, landmarks such as the Perrine Coulee Falls, the Perrine Bridge, and the Snake River loom large for amazing pictures. Other locations that make for good graduation photos include Shoshone Falls, Thousand Springs State Park, Balanced Rock, and Twin Falls City Park.
